Mesothelioma Claims

Compensation claims are often filed by people with mesothelioma, as well as their families. The compensation could come from trust funds, lawsuit payouts or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) benefits.

A law firm experienced in filing mesothelioma law firms lawsuits can help victims and family members get the justice they deserve. A mesothelioma lawyer could make the process less stressful.

Work History

Mesothelioma patients can claim compensation through a variety of insurance. Patients diagnosed with mesothelioma can pursue a personal injury suit against the asbestos companies that are responsible for their exposure. Compensation may pay for medical expenses, lost wages and funeral costs.

Mesothelioma suits can result in large sums of money that can help patients and families recover from this debilitating illness. These lawsuits also make asbestos companies accountable and urge them to avoid further asbestos exposure.

Veterans who were exposed to asbestos during their time in the military forces may also be eligible for benefits of the veteran, such as disability payments. VA benefits can be used to assist families pay for the treatment of mesothelioma legal as well as other costs related to this disease.

Mesothelioma sufferers can consult with an attorney to determine if they're eligible to file a lawsuit or trust fund. Depending on the type of claim that you file, you may be required to collect medical records, work history, and other evidence in order to prove your claim.

Experienced mesothelioma attorneys (Web Site) will know the best method for gathering and reviewing the evidence to ensure that all legal rights are secured. They can also work with health insurance companies as well as the VA to ensure that all compensation resources are available.

Individuals who are diagnosed with mesothelioma can also be able to claim compensation through asbestos trust funds. Many asbestos companies have established trusts to compensate injured people without having to resort to litigation. An experienced mesothelioma law firm can assist individuals in determining if the company responsible for their exposure is a member of a trust and walk through the steps of filing a claim.

Mesothelioma trust funds provide compensation awards based on the person's asbestos exposure and diagnosis. The funds aren't enough, and some have been exhausted. In the end those who are eligible should consider filing multiple trusts.

Mesothelioma lawyers with national connections can assist people make this choice. They can also help coordinate mesothelioma suits and trust fund claims so that the client receives the maximum compensation.

Asbestos Exposure

Asbestos victims can be eligible for compensation if they suffer from m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related disease. This could help pay for medical expenses and other expenses associated with treatment. Compensation can provide victims and their families peace of peace of. An attorney for mesothelioma can help victims through the claim process and protect their legal rights.

Mesothelioma affects the thin membranes that surround joints and organs of the body. It is usually caused by exposure to asbestos, which is a family of minerals with microscopic fibres. These fibres can easily be inhaled or eaten and cause lung damage. In the 20th century, asbestos was used in a variety of applications.

Asbestos victims may bring lawsuits against the manufacturers who exposed them to this harmful material. These lawsuits may result in a settlement out of court or a verdict in court. A lot of mesothelioma lawsuits are settled before reaching trial.

A qualified asbestos attorney can review a patient's work record to determine the place and when they were exposed to asbestos. The lawyers can identify the parties responsible. The list may include asbestos companies as well as manufacturers of asbestos-containing construction material or products and shipyards.

The strength of a mesothelioma case can be significantly enhanced by determining the extent of an individual's exposure to asbestos. Asbestos lawyers can look over medical documents as well as laboratory tests and other evidence to calculate a patient's asbestos exposure and the extent of their mesothelioma.

In some instances, the family of a mesothelioma sufferer may bring an action for wrongful deaths to claim compensation for the patient. A lawyer can help families understand the statute of limitations for mesothelioma as well as other rules and regulations applicable to these kinds of cases.

In addition, mesothelioma patients and their families may file for workers' compensation or disability benefits. These benefits can cover lost income or help pay for expenses for living. Patients with mesothelioma may also be eligible for special monthly payments from Veterans Affairs.

Statute of Limitations

A statute of limitation is a law which sets the maximum time frame for victims to file a lawsuit. The time frame for a statute of limitations can differ by state and according to the kind of claim. Mesothelioma lawsuits typically have different limitations periods than other personal injury lawsuits. This is due to the fact that mesothelioma may take a long time to manifest and a lot of victims won't know they have the disease until they are diagnosed with it.

It is crucial that patients with mesothelioma contact an attorney as soon as they can. A specialist can assist patients file their claim on time and compile all the documents they require for the case.

A mesothelioma claim can be filed against any company which exposed the victim to asbestos, which includes the responsible party's insurance companies. Victims may seek compensation for medical expenses as well as pain and discomfort and other damages. They can also receive an award to replace the loss of income from being unable to work due to illness.

Additionally, family members of mesothelioma patients can bring wrongful death lawsuits against the responsible parties. Generally, the statute of limitations for a wrongful death claim begins when the victim dies. Certain states have rules allowing the clock of the statute of limitations to start when the victim is diagnosed with mesothelioma.

It is crucial to make mesothelioma-related claims early enough as the evidence will diminish over time. Additionally, some states have shorter statutes of limitation than others for asbestos cases.

The time-limit for filing mesothelioma cases will be contingent on where the defendants are located and where the victim resides or worked. In general, a mesothelioma lawsuit must be filed in the state in which the exposure occurred.

A mesothelioma attorney must also be familiar with the specific statutes of limitation in every state. This will ensure that a claim is timely filed and the victim is not denied their right to compensation.
